Critical Power
More equipment and higher GPU density equate to the need for more power. Data is being driven at an all-time high rate which is causing an increase in computing speed derived from training and inference workloads and seeing 12x more power required to the rack. Power will have to be thought of in a different light including the need for utilizing off-grid supplies such as renewable energy.
Fiber Connectivity
Fiber will be utilized for all rack-to-rack and most in-rack connections. Having the right fiber architecture implemented will resolve network latency issues and provide a pristine focus on GPU-GPU communication. To connect all of the GPUs to create a cluster (or pod) needed for larger-scale AI, fiber cabling and high-speed optical transceivers are required. In return, having the right Fiber connectivity in place can work effortlessly to maintain the high-speed data transfer that stems from the continuous learning of AI models.
Cooling
The increase in the number of AI and HPC systems in data centers and their high-power usage per rack is speeding up the need for innovative cooling methods. There are several cooling options available, including typical air cooling, air-assisted liquid cooling, and direct liquid cooling. Which one is the right one for your application? Not having the right cooling method in place can cause equipment failure, system downtime, and a rise in energy costs.
Pathways
Cable routing is a key component in managing an AI Data Center network. With AI clusters requiring a new environment and GPU servers needing much more connectivity between servers the proper cable management application must be installed to prevent physical damage that can result in a disruption of critical network connections.
Cabinets, Racks, and Containment
Containing higher densities will be a major challenge for data center operators as they prepare to transform their layout, and many will choose a rack and stack method to accommodate the higher load and deeper cabinets. High-density racks are required to support high-performance compute and AI workloads and in return will have a minimal impact on power consumption. In addition, having a dedicated containment solution in place will help align cooling strategies to combat high power demands.
